Digital Nature of Game Content All purchases made within or related to Epic Seven, including but not limited to summoning currency, upgrade packs, event bundles, and limited-time offers, are classified as non-physical digital goods. These items are delivered instantly and are considered non-refundable under standard conditions. 2. Valid Scenarios for Refund Consideration Though most transactions are final, we acknowledge that rare exceptions may arise. Refunds may be considered only under the following circumstances: Technical Errors: If an item or currency was purchased but never delivered due to a verified system malfunction. Unintended Duplicate Purchase: If the same item was purchased more than once due to a user interface error or lag. Unauthorized Transactions: If there is clear and verified evidence that a transaction was made fraudulently or without the account owner's consent. Purchase Failure with Deduction: If payment was processed, but the transaction failed, and content was not received. Every claim will be individually reviewed for authenticity and validity. 3. Submitting a Request To request a refund, players must provide detailed information about the issue, including relevant order identifiers, in-game details, and a complete description of the error or concern. Each case will be evaluated on its own merits, and additional information may be requested to verify the claim. 4. When Refunds Cannot Be Issued The following conditions do not qualify for a refund under this policy: Regret after completing a purchase Dissatisfaction with the outcome of a summon or gacha result Accidental purchases caused by misclicks, unless duplicated and unused Use of purchased items before submitting a refund request General complaints about game difficulty, performance, or progression Device incompatibility or personal technical limitations We strongly recommend that players double-check their intended purchases before confirming. 5. External Platform Transactions If a purchase was made through a third-party provider such as a mobile app store or platform-based marketplace, the refund process must be handled directly through that platform. We do not control or influence refund decisions made by those entities. 6. Abuse and Policy Misuse Attempts to abuse the refund system through repeated requests, deceptive information, or exploitation of known bugs may result in account limitations, revocation of purchases, or permanent suspension.
